Kyle Thrash is an American documentary and music video director.

'The Seat' is an unprecedented inside look that led to a once-in-a-generation driver change in Mercedes and F1 history. It reveals the private conversations that led the Mercedes team and Toto Wolff, its Team Principal and CEO, to its decision to promote 18-year-old Italian-born Kimi Antonelli to a Formula 1 Driver, making him the third-youngest rookie in the sport's history. The film follows Kimi, in the lead up to his first Formula 1 season as he takes on his destiny.

High Times traces the outlaw ambition of Tom Forcade, a rebel publisher who turned risk into revolution. Fueled by the spirit of the Free Press movement, he smuggled cannabis to bankroll High Times Magazine—a publication that didn’t just document a subculture, but helped ignite and legitimize it. What began as a defiant act became a cultural force, reshaping the narrative around marijuana and leaving a lasting imprint on society.

Michael Thompson is the longest serving non-violent offender in the history of Michigan and he is finally up for clemency. After 25 years, 3 appeals, and 2 denied applications for clemency it seems like Michael may finally have a chance at freedom.
